M. R. Tadayon is a scholar working on Plant Science, Agronomy and Crop Science and Soil Science. According to data from OpenAlex, M. R. Tadayon has authored 43 papers receiving a total of 472 indexed citations (citations by other indexed papers that have themselves been cited), including 31 papers in Plant Science, 12 papers in Agronomy and Crop Science and 7 papers in Soil Science. Recurrent topics in M. R. Tadayon's work include Crop Yield and Soil Fertility (7 papers), Rice Cultivation and Yield Improvement (6 papers) and Agronomic Practices and Intercropping Systems (6 papers). M. R. Tadayon is often cited by papers focused on Crop Yield and Soil Fertility (7 papers), Rice Cultivation and Yield Improvement (6 papers) and Agronomic Practices and Intercropping Systems (6 papers). M. R. Tadayon collaborates with scholars based in Iran, United Kingdom and Canada. M. R. Tadayon's co-authors include Jamshid Razmjoo, Mumtaz Cheema, Muhammad Nadeem, R. W. Lewis, Mohammad Kafi, Ahmad Nezami, Ali Tadayyon, Rahim Ebrahimi, Muhammad Nadeem and Rooholla Moradi and has published in prestigious journals such as International Journal for Numerical Methods in Engineering, Industrial Crops and Products and Agricultural Water Management.
